Porta-Bote

I thought I would lay this on for those of you that would want to have a small boat with you when you are traveling. We just bought a Porta-Bote that folds up to 4 inches thick X 24 inches wide and 12 feet long! It weighs 58 lbs. You read it right!!! We just had our maiden voyage yesterday and everything works great. We have a 5HP motor to make it go and it weighs just 60 lbs. I am making mounting brackets for underneath the Monty in the front. Going to Chesapeake bay the end of the month. It has a capacity for 500 lbs, has 3 seats, and made of polyproplyene. Will keep you posted on the mounts. Dave,
There was a thread quite a while ago talking about these. At the time, I opted to go with an inflatable kayak as a canoe replacement. I remain interested in the Porta-Bote though, because my legs liked the canoe better than they like the kayak. Can you share the cost? I'd also be interested in hearing how your mounting process goes. I really don't want to mount it on the side or the roof. The bottom is logical, but like many, I've never pulled the bottom panels. Gordon 'n Carol;
We paid $1399 for a 12' boat. This included shipping from California, oars and a bar to help unfold it. A 5HP Nissan motor was $1199. It is avery nice motor! When I am done with the brackets, I will post pictures.
